Remove Oil Filter Cap and Drain Plug. 1] SAE 15W-40 engine oil is preferred in all instances when the ambient temperature is greater than 0° F. [2] SAE 5W-40 engine oil is required in instances when the ambient temperature is less than 0° F. Although it is acceptable in all ambient temperatures, it is not preferred over 15W-40 when ambient temperatures are above 0° F. [3] SAE 10W-30 engine oil is acceptable within the listed temperature range for 2001 to 2007 model years only.
